Event Description
On (b)(6) 2016, the reporter contacted animas, alleging a casing/condition (case damage with moisture) issue.Reportedly, the battery compartment was damaged and there was moisture/corrosion in the pump.There is no indication that the product issue caused or contributed to an adverse event.This complaint is being reported as the alleged malfunction has the ability to result in a delay in treatment or long term cessation in delivery if the damage impacts the power circuit or cartridge compartment.
 
Manufacturer Narrative
Follow-up #1: date of submission 09/21/2016.Device evaluation: the device has been returned and evaluated by product analysis on 08/29/2016 with the following findings: investigation revealed moisture corrosion on the display lens; the display screen remained fully functional.There was no physical damage observed to the pump.Leak testing revealed a display lens leak.The pump cover was removed and there was evidence of moisture corrosion found to the continuous glucose monitoring module, the power printed circuit board, and the keypad connector.Unrelated to the original complaint, investigation revealed that the up arrow keypad button was unresponsive.There were no defects found to the keypad cover or to the button contacts.
